Output 2ec1a907691e743b9e705df008d34e695ba5cd067d88f072efeafc52e0f16422:0

value
9378740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8c618b23163f5899b53bdcb457a19cac156e185 OP_EQUALVERIFY OP_CHECKSIG
address
1KJbTMJZrVNUQ5Drxc1TpgRk64DW3uTN3b
transaction
2ec1a907691e743b9e705df008d34e695ba5cd067d88f072efeafc52e0f16422
spent
true